3.5 Voltage Program
3.5.1 Voltage Mode
Under voltage mode, the user may control the full scale output voltage value through Pin 9, by
inputting a voltage level of 0-5 V (0-5 V
/
0-5 kΩ mode) or 0-10 V (0-10 V
/
0-10 kΩ mode) as shown
below.

3.5.2 Resistor Mode
Under resistor mode, the user may control the full scale voltage output value by connecting a resistance
value of 0-5 kΩ (0-5 V
/
0-5 kΩ mode) or 0-10 kΩ (0-10 V
/
0-10 kΩ mode) between Pin 9 and Pin 22 as
shown below.

3.5.2.1 Current Program
3.5.2.2 Voltage Mode
Under voltage mode, the user may control the full scale current output value through Pin 10, by
inputting a voltage level of 0-5V (0-5 V
/
0-5 kΩ mode) or 0-10V (0-10 V
/
0-10 kΩ mode) as shown
below.

3.5.2.3 Resistor Mode
Under resistor mode, the user may control the full scale current output value by connecting a resistance
value of 0-5 kΩ (0-5 V
/
0-5 kΩ mode) or 0-10 kΩ (0-10 V
/
0-10 kΩ mode) between Pin 10 and Pin 23 as
shown below.
